From Technician to Leader: ITSM Career Growth Strategies

Transitioning from a technician role as the realm of IT Service Management (ITSM) leadership can be a challenging journey. Leveraging your technical foundation while cultivating essential leadership skills is key to navigating this road.

First of all, prioritize structured training programs and certifications that support your ITSM knowledge base. Know industry best practices including ITIL, COBIT, and ISO/IEC 20000. Interacting with seasoned ITSM professionals can provide invaluable guidance.

Passionately participate in industry events, join professional organizations, and collaborate with peers to increase your network.

  • Exhibit strong communication, problem-solving, and decision-making skills.
  • Seek out opportunities to lead projects and teams, showcasing your supervisory abilities.
  • Keep abreast on emerging ITSM trends and technologies through continuous learning.

Remember, tenacity and a willingness to learn are crucial for realizing your ITSM leadership goals. By carefully enhancing your skills and expanding your network, you can triumphantly advance from a technician to a respected leader in the ITSM field.
